If you have a Pioneer DVD writer do not make the same mistake as me. I used
4x DVD media in my Pioneer DVR-103 writer (badged as a LaCie Firewire DVD
writer) and it trashed the machine.

Pioneer's web-site is very clear about the problems with 4x media, and they
give clear instructions about how to update the firmware to avoid potential
problems, but in my case by the time I read all this info on their site it
was too late, I had already tried to use 4x discs and they say that my DVD
writer is uneconomic to repair.

These Pioneer drives also feature in Apple Macs, Compaq and Sony computers
and in various other boxes (eg LaCie) as OEM drives. The DVR-104 is also
affected.

Pioneer's site tells you how to tell if your DVD writer is at risk, and how
to fix it:
